Output 96643106ec58a28e4ec1fb1a207e7baf6b84f3b05b92f515376630e179d54a99:8

value
1367004
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29c4aa9434ec89ae7ac92e6c8302281b61a3f863 OP_EQUALVERIFY OP_CHECKSIG
address
14orJUtPNZ9kJwHmNYJpz3B4jTveUVCrWe
transaction
96643106ec58a28e4ec1fb1a207e7baf6b84f3b05b92f515376630e179d54a99
spent
true